Transaction bf95638ca3e63f13b1d96ac00fc110dd9be859aa43bb91829a4f2decef8ad0a3
1 Input
1 Output
-
bf95638ca3e63f13b1d96ac00fc110dd9be859aa43bb91829a4f2decef8ad0a3:0
- value
- 3062946
- script pubkey
- OP_0 OP_PUSHBYTES_20 15d34d866f9d11434b0af7085ed45d3ebc0365ac
- address
- bc1qzhf5mpn0n5g5xjc27uy9a4za867qxedv3j7zky